A daring rescue. A family betrayal. A spy in the making.In the rugged mountains of eastern Afghanistan, elite operative Afsar Ramos is sent to do a difficult task: infiltrate hostile territory, locate a hidden compound, and rescue three UN hostages before time runs out. Armed with only a small team, a suppressed Sig Sauer, and an iron will, Afsar races against enemy eyes and the ghosts of his past.However, a single sniper's bullet exposes a devastating truth - Afsar's enemy is not a stranger. It's his own blood.Afsar must confront the twisted legacy of a family torn apart by betrayal. Haunted by visions, driven to vengeance, and supported by Ashlynn, the young woman who is becoming more than just a fling, Afsar knows what he must do.Because some enemies wear the face of family. And some missions never end.Perfect for fans of Brad Thor, Vince Flynn, and Jack Carr, Son of Afghanistan is a high-stakes spy thriller packed with covert ops, emotional depth, and pulse-pounding action.
